In order to complete an online application, you will need:
High school transcripts: Students are required to furnish evidence (transcript showing graduation, GED, CHSPE, or equivalent) of completion of high school to be granted admission to undergraduate programs. Those students who hold an associate degree or higher from a regionally accredited college/university upon admission do not need to furnish a high school transcript, unless required to validate specific course work.All official transcripts must be received and processed by LLU before an acceptance can be offered. (Exception: applications that have come through AMCAS, AADSAS, CASPA, PharmCAS, PTCAS, or SOPHAS. However, for these applicants, all official transcripts must be sent directly from the issuing institutions to LLU and processed by LLU before registration.) International students must have all required admissions materials (including transcripts) received and processed before an I-20 can be issued even if they applied through one of the application services listed above.
Transcripts received by LLU become the property of LLU and will not be returned to the applicant or forwarded to any other institution. Please do not send us your original transcript/diploma if no other copy exists.

Loma Linda, CA 92350 USAElectronic transcripts can be officially sent to LLU in the following ways. Check with your prior school to find out if they are set up to use any of these methods. Send secure PDFs to admissions.app@llu.edu (see below for security requirements for PDFs). Please note: LLU cannot accept PDF transcripts through the National Student Clearinghouse transcript service. If your prior school uses this service for PDF transcripts, please instead have an official paper copy sent to LLU.
- EDI - school code 001218, qual 22, through the UT Austin SPEEDE Server (info)
- PDF with security components (e.g. multi-steps to access, login registration, password, watermark, etc) and without restrictions on printing and/or saving/archiving. PDF transcripts must be issued directly to admissions.app@llu.edu. Examples of accepted PDF transcripts include those sent through Parchment Exchange, Scrip-Safe, Credentials Solutions, and JST (Joint Services Transcript, for US Military credit).
- PDF transcripts that cannot be accepted as official:
- Those containing PDF security that restricts printing, number/time of access, saving, etc.
- PDF transcripts through the National Student Clearinghouse transript request service. (Instead request an official paper transcript or an electronic transcript in another accepted format.)
- Transcripts emailed as attachments (PDF or other formats).
Transcripts must be sent by the issuing institution directly to LLU Admissions Processing, preferably with the LLU transcript request form which will speed the processing of your transcript. For international transcripts, photocopies of personal transcript copies may be sent back to the issuing institution for signed and stamped verification, then mailed by the institution directly to LLU. See the International Transcripts page for more information and some country-specific instructions. Transcripts that are hand-carried or mailed by anyone other than the issuing institution, even if in a sealed envelope, are not considered official.
International education where credit was received, no matter the length of time, and including for US students, must be officially transcripted. Please refer to our International Transcripts page for more information.
